Perdue Brandon Fielder Collins & Mott, LLP Introduce

In the vast state of Texas, the smooth functioning of cities, counties, school districts, and other governmental entities relies heavily on the efficient collection of vital revenues. From property taxes to court fines and fees, these collections fund essential public services that directly impact the lives of Texans every day. It's in this specialized and crucial area of law that Perdue Brandon Fielder Collins & Mott, LLP, has established itself as a leading authority. Based in Arlington, this firm brings decades of experience to the table, working exclusively with governmental clients to maximize their revenue and ensure the continuation of necessary community services.

Perdue Brandon Fielder Collins & Mott, LLP is not a typical law firm that handles individual or business disputes in the conventional sense. Instead, their practice is entirely focused on providing customized collection services and related legal representation to governmental entities across Texas. Established in Amarillo in 1970, they have grown to become one of the oldest and largest law firms of their type in the state, with offices in numerous Texas cities, including Arlington.

Their approach is rooted in principles of hard work, ethical conduct, and a commitment to proven results. They leverage extensive experience and statewide resources to design collection plans that are both effective and sensitive, acknowledging the challenges individuals may face while ensuring that public funds are recovered. For Texas government clients seeking a reliable and experienced partner in revenue collection and related legal counsel, Perdue Brandon Fielder Collins & Mott, LLP, offers a specialized solution.

Services Offered

Perdue Brandon Fielder Collins & Mott, LLP, specializes exclusively in providing comprehensive collection services and legal representation to governmental entities. Their expertise is tailored to maximize revenue for their clients, which include a wide array of public sector organizations across Texas. Key services they offer include:

  • Delinquent Property Tax Collections: They assist cities, counties, school districts, appraisal districts, and other governmental entities in collecting overdue property taxes. This involves a complete process from taxpayer notification and lienholder notification to active litigation, bankruptcy collections, tax warrants, seizures, and tax lien foreclosures. They also provide representation in condemnation cases and offer counsel in all ad valorem tax matters.
  • Delinquent Fines & Fees Collections: The firm works with cities and counties to recover delinquent court fines, municipal fees, and other miscellaneous receivables. Their services in this area include specialized collection software, computerized mass mailings, verbal contacts with violators, and follow-up correspondence. They also assist with "Warrant Round-Up" programs and can accept various payment methods.
  • Toll Road Violations Collections: Perdue Brandon provides specialized collection services for delinquent toll road violations, working with toll authorities to recover unpaid tolls and associated fees. Their "Toll Team" comprises experienced attorneys and staff who understand the intricacies of the toll industry.
  • Appraisal District Representation: They advise numerous appraisal districts on property tax matters and represent them in litigation involving valuation, exemptions, special appraisal designations, and other property tax issues. This specialized legal counsel helps appraisal districts navigate complex legal challenges.
  • Legislative Updates and Bill Drafting: As a firm deeply integrated with governmental law, they provide legislative updates and assist in drafting proposed bills relevant to their clients' interests and collection efforts.
  • Assistance in Negotiating Settlements: While their primary role is collection for governmental entities, they also assist in negotiating settlements for various delinquent accounts, often seeking to resolve matters efficiently.
  • Legal Representation for Governmental Entities: Beyond collections, the firm provides professional legal representation to its governmental clients, ensuring they are bound by a code of conduct and subject to professional disciplinary measures, upholding ethical standards in all their operations.

I first became familiar with Ben Parsons of the Perdue Law Firm because after my mother's death I was notified that the City had filed a tax suit against her property. I had no idea what to do and little money. Ben sat with me and explained how the suit was progressing and helped me work thru the unbelievable delinquency and together we came up with a payment plan for me to save our family home. Mr. Perdue must be a very good lawyer because he and his firm understand the importance of hiring the exceptional. My experience with this law firm and Ben Parsons was proof that there are ways to accomplish the impossible when we work together to succeed. Thank you Perdue, Brandon, Fielder, Collins & Mott for having the insight to search and hire the "exceptional"
